How Lifestyle Choices May Influence Cancer Risk

While not all cancers can be prevented, research suggests that everyday lifestyle choices may influence risk over time.


๐Ÿ”ฌ Key Factors Linked to Risk

According to World Health Organization:

  • Tobacco use remains the leading preventable cause
  • Diet and physical activity play a role
  • Alcohol consumption is linked to several cancers

๐Ÿ“Š What Studies Suggest

  • Maintaining a healthy weight may reduce risk
  • Diets rich in fruits and vegetables are associated with better outcomes
  • Regular exercise supports overall cellular health

โš ๏ธ Important Context

  • Genetics and environmental exposure also matter
  • Lifestyle changes reduce risk โ€” not eliminate it
